Offshore wind zone declared in the Southern Ocean
The Offshore Infrastructure Registrar is now accepting feasibility licence applications for offshore wind projects in the Southern Ocean.
Located at least 15-20km from Victoria’s coast the third officially declared offshore wind zone could generate up to 2.9GW of offshore wind energy.

Consultation launched for Bunbury offshore wind zone
The Department of Climate Change, Energy the Environment and Water has begun public consultation on a proposed Bunbury offshore wind zone, off the coast of Western Australia.

Area proposed for offshore renewables within Bass Strait
The Department of Climate Change, Energy the Environment and Water (DCCEEW) is inviting feedback on the suitability of another area deemed potentially suitable for offshore renewable energy development.
What’s involved in developing an offshore wind farm?
The design, construction, transportation and installation of large structures offshore is technically challenging and requires many years of detailed planning before an offshore windfarm becomes operational.
